Use the sentence to answer the question. A Baltimore oriole is a kind of bird. Which type of relationship is described in this s

entence? item-category part-whole object-function cause-effect
English
1 answer:
Aleksandr [31]3 years ago
7 0
Item - category. Baltimore oriole is one type of item in the larger category of birds
